About The Old Pheasant
The Old Pheasant is a listed property close to Rutland Water, in the most British county in England. Whether on business or a leisure break, we will do our utmost to help you relax and enjoy your stay. Having reopened in August of 2005, we have created an inviting environment in which to wine and dine. Our chef has experience in Michelin starred kitchens and creates dishes from fresh local produce which are already winning rave reviews. We compliment this with an extensive, carefully chosen wine list and a good selection of real ales.
